Rowena Price è una giornalista d'assalto, bella e decisa. Dopo un contrasto con il direttore del suo giornale, si prende una pausa di riflessione: ma l'omicidio di un'amica d'infanzia, legato al mondo di Internet, la induce ad assumere una nuova identità e a dedicarsi anima e corpo a un'indagine che si rivela assai complessa. Accanto a lei si muovono l'hacker Miles, che le presta il suo aiuto, e l'ambiguo colosso della pubblicità Harrison Hill, erotomane e rampante...
